"Were still going to play Shawn Bryson and alternate him with Artose Pinner," head coach Steve Mariucci said. "However, Artose will probably get more snaps than he did last week."
With a losing record guaranteed, Mariucci is trying to evaluate as many of his young players as possible before the end of the season. And Pinner obviously falls into that category.
The Lions rank dead last in the NFL in rushing yardage, averaging 83.8 yards per game. They have had only one 100-yard rushing game all season, a 105-yarder by Shawn Bryson last Sunday at Kansas City.
Mariucci and team president Matt Millen have to decide where a running back falls in their list of needs-to-be-filled before the 2004 season.
Veteran James Stewart rushed for more than 1,000 yards in two of his three years with the Lions but missed the entire 2003 season with a dislocated shoulder that required surgery. Bryson and Olandis Gary have 964 yards between them but Bryson is averaging 3.9 yards per carry and Gary 3.4 yards per carry.
It appears only a matter of time before they go after a more explosive back but if Pinner shows enough promise as a complement to Stewart, they might try to fill other needs before running back. ...
